DESCRIPTION:Sound Arts Initiatives is thrilled to present this unique\, immersive\, and transformative multi-media performance combining lighting\, gesture\, audiovisual\, staging\, text\, violin\, and percussion\, in St. John’s for the first time at the historic Majestic Theatre. \nConceived for two exceptional musicians—Aiyun Huang\, percussionist\, and Mark Fewer\, violinist—the project examines how our clocks respond to one another\, to the passage of time\, to stress\, and to emotions. The two instruments embody distinct yet complementary temporalities\, symbolizing the diversity of human experiences.\nMystery of Clock combines design\, dramaturge\, musical composition\, text\, improvisation and performance to create a highly immersive musical and theatrical experience for the general audience. The musicians are story tellers\, human beings who traverse between quasi real-life and fictional states of being musicians\, intimate souls\, and fictional characters—creating imaginative musical tales that leave one wonders about the blurry lines between reality and fantasy. \nEach scene is an exploration of a key theme: memory\, stress\, love\, the irreversibility of time… The violin and percussion become mirrors of the human soul: fragile\, complex\, deeply connected.
